A heavy, slanted display sans built from sharp planar cuts rather than smooth curves. Strokes are broad and consistent, with chamfered corners, beveled terminals, and squared counters that create a faceted, machined look. Proportions lean extended and compact at once—wide silhouettes with tight internal apertures—while the lowercase maintains a high x-height and short ascenders/descenders for dense, punchy setting. The overall rhythm is forward-leaning and dynamic, with distinctive angled joins and occasional cut-in notches that emphasize the geometric construction.

Best suited for headlines, titles, and short bursts of text where impact matters more than subtlety. It works well in sports and esports identities, gaming interfaces, event posters, packaging, and apparel graphics, especially when paired with strong color and high-contrast layouts.

The tone is forceful and high-energy, evoking speed, competition, and rugged utility. Its faceted shapes and hard edges suggest a tactical, engineered aesthetic with a modern, tech-forward attitude.

The design appears intended to deliver maximum punch with a streamlined, speed-oriented voice, using faceted geometry and aggressive slant to convey motion and toughness. Its large interior shapes and simplified construction aim for strong recognition in branding and display settings.

The numerals and caps read especially strong thanks to their broad faces and clipped corners, while the lowercase keeps the same angular vocabulary for a cohesive texture in longer lines. The slant and tight apertures increase visual momentum but can reduce clarity at small sizes, favoring bold, impactful use.
